BAKED EGGS IN TOMATO CUPS

When looking for something different for a cooked breakfast, thinking eggs seeing the big beef tomatoes we had ... this idea popped into my head.

Time 30m

Yield 2 halves of tomato, 2 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 10

1 beef tomatoes (about 300g)
75 g red onions
2 large eggs
6 large basil leaves
1 tablespoon red wine vinegar
2 teaspoons sugar
1 tablespoon tomato puree
1/2 teaspoon sea salt
1/2 teaspoon black pepper
5 g grated parmegano cheese

Steps:

  • Cut 1 large beef tomato in half and hollow out the centre (do not discard).
  • Drop in a little fresh basil and a few rings of red onion then bake in the oven for about 5 minutes to soften them a little.
  • While the tomato is in the oven take the removed pulp and finely chop along with most of the remaining red onion (save about 6 thin rings of onion).
  • add the sugar, tomato purée, chopped basil leaves, salt, pepper and red wine vinegar and cook down into a thick sauce.
  • Remove the tomato cups from the oven and crack in one egg into each half.
  • Drop the rings of onion (you previously saved) into each tomato cup.
  • add a small pile of grated Parmegano cheese on top (try to leave the yolk showing for presentation).
  • Sprinkle with pepper and carefully place in the red hot oven for another 5-10 minutes (until the egg has cooked).
  • Serve half covered with the tomato pickle/ketchup you have made.
  • works well with a slice of toasted brown bread.
  • Serve hot.
